The Roles
Opportunities exist to join as Technicians within the Product Development and Quality teams???

Product Development Scientist
The Product Development team is looking to hire a qualified scientist. You will ideally be looking to start your scientific career in the commercial sector and have a BSc/MSC or PhD qualified in an immunology based subject. You will be working within defined workstreams directed at improvements in current assays, and identification of further opportunities and applications for the company's T-SPOT technology within the development pipeline.

Quality Technician
Responsible for ensuring QC of finished product and raw materials and for supporting the smooth running of the Quality Management System. This role works alongside laboratory and manufacturing departments within the business and is ideally suited to a biological sciences graduate with experience of cell culture who is looking to pursue a career in quality management.

This is a great opportunity for proactive and responsible science graduates to develop their understanding of the diagnostic and pharmaceutical industries. A good understanding of cell culture and cellular biology techniques is essential. Previous experience of working in a GMP laboratory and working with SOPs is essential for all the roles.
